WebAug 18, 2009 · Perhaps most important in the course of this research, NRL has synthesized phthalonitrile-based thermosets that reportedly exhibit no softening at service temperatures as high as 932°F/500°C, when initially cured at 482°F/250°C and postcured at up to 896°F/480°C in an inert atmosphere.
